Key Ingredients of Baljiwan Ghutti
Baljiwan Ghutti contains a blend of herbal ingredients, including Swarna Patri, Argbadha, Banafsa, Tankan, Slesamantaka, Misreya, Satapushpa, Haritaki, Draksha, and Nil Kamal. These herbs are traditionally known for their digestive, nourishing, and wellness-supporting properties. The formulation is also rich in calcium and iron, essential nutrients for healthy growth and development in children.
